CIS 4990 - Enterprise Project


This is the capstone course of the CIS curriculum. Applications of computer, programming, and system knowledge, and skills gained from the previous classes are applied in developing an enterprise-wide software project. Some industrial enterprise-wide packages are reviewed. A team approach is applied to develop and integrate different computerized business functions into an integrated software system. Project management techniques and computer simulated solutions are formally presented to emphasize team dynamics and management skills. Students taking this course are required to have a laptop computer meeting the minimum specifications defined by the Haworth College of Business.

Prerequisites & Corequisites: Prerequisite: CIS 4600.

Credits: 3 hours
